Abstract

The invention discloses unblanking of a kind of safety intelligent lock, close lock control method, based on safety intelligent lock system, safety intelligent lock system comprises tapered end, key, portable electric appts and long-range main website, this portable electric appts communicates to connect this long-range main website, this key connects this portable electric appts by Bluetooth communication, this key communicates to connect this tapered end, this portable electric appts is provided with bluetooth module, by this tapered end, key, connection communication between portable electric appts and long-range main website, realize unlocking action and a series of Information Authentication before unblanking and password authentification to ensure securely unlocking.Lock system cost is low, intelligence, easy to operate, safe and reliable, prevent from being opened by mistake lock, simultaneously owing to have employed overall management, the information storage function of communication network and main website, can the information such as the operand of switch lock, operating personnel, Obj State, running time effectively be recorded and be managed, the perfect management system of power domain.

Embodiment
Please refer to Fig. 1, a kind of control method of unblanking of safety intelligent lock, based on safety intelligent lock system, safety intelligent lock system comprises tapered end, key, portable electric appts and long-range main website, this portable electric appts communicates to connect this long-range main website, this key connects this portable electric appts by Bluetooth communication, this key communicates to connect this tapered end, this portable electric appts is provided with bluetooth module, this portable electric appts is provided with software module, this software module supports user to log in and order sends, by this tapered end, key, connection communication between portable electric appts and long-range main website, realize unlocking action and a series of Information Authentication before unblanking and password authentification to ensure securely unlocking,
Please refer to Fig. 2, based on this safety intelligent lock, before electric system is unblanked, after obtaining operation order and obtaining the login account of software module and password, unblank according to following step of unblanking:
Step 11, user carries out the login of portable electric appts software module according to account and password, if login successfully, performs step 12, otherwise, login failure, portable electric appts prompting logs in failure; In the present embodiment, this software module is an app software.
Step 12, portable electric appts is connected to long-range main website application portable electric appts with the Bluetooth communication between key;
Step 13, long-range main website sends the password after algorithm for encryption to portable electric appts and starts timing, and meanwhile, this tapered end generates corresponding identical password according to identical algorithm, if this timing time arrives, then returns step 12, otherwise, perform step 14; In the present embodiment, the Bluetooth communication tie-time between portable electric appts and key is set as 60s, if 60s timing is arrived, then needs again to be connected to main website application portable electric appts with the bluetooth between key, to guarantee the safety of encrypting rear password, ensure securely unlocking; This password after algorithm for encryption generates by AES encryption technology.
Step 14, if two codon pair in step 13 are answered, then this portable electric appts and the successful connection of key Bluetooth communication, portable electric appts is unblanked to main website application, and performs step 15, otherwise, return step 12;
Step 15, portable electric appts issues main website IP/ port numbers to tapered end;
Step 16, whether the IP/ port numbers that tapered end checking portable electric appts issues stores with itself consistent, if unanimously, then lock address is sent to main website by tapered end, continues to perform step 17, otherwise portable electric appts prompting main website IP/ port numbers is inconsistent;
Step 17, main website generates unlocking cipher according to lock address according to cryptographic algorithm and is handed down to tapered end; In the present embodiment, this cryptographic algorithm adopts AES encryption algorithm.
Step 18, tapered end generates corresponding password according to identical cryptographic algorithm and is decrypted, if successful decryption, then tapered end performs unlocking action.
In the present embodiment, its step of unblanking also comprises step 19, and this tapered end judges to unblank success or not, and portable electric appts prompting is unblanked successfully or failure the relative recording of unblanking is uploaded to main website; Retain relative recording, check history can be carried out by main website, the information such as operand, operating personnel, Obj State, running time of switch lock is effectively recorded and managed, the perfect management system of power domain.
Please refer to Fig. 3, the step of unblanking of corresponding above-mentioned a kind of safety intelligent lock, based on this safety intelligent lock system, it shuts and comprises the following steps:
It shuts step and comprises:
Step 21, after unblanking, the Bluetooth communication successful connection of portable electric appts and key,
Step 22, portable electric appts shuts to main website application;
Step 23, portable electric appts issues main website IP/ port numbers to tapered end;
Step 24, whether the IP/ port numbers that tapered end checking portable electric appts issues stores with itself consistent, if unanimously, then lock address is sent to main website by tapered end, continues to perform step 25, otherwise portable electric appts prompting main website IP/ port numbers is inconsistent;
Step 25, main website shuts delivering key to lock according to lock address according to cryptographic algorithm generation; In the present embodiment, this cryptographic algorithm adopts AES encryption algorithm.
Step 26, tapered end generates corresponding password according to identical cryptographic algorithm and is decrypted, if successful decryption, then tapered end performs and shuts action.
In the present embodiment, this shuts step and also comprises step 27, and this tapered end judges to shut success or not, and portable electric appts prompting shuts successfully or failure the relative recording shut is uploaded to main website, and reservation record.
In order to increase the security of this safety intelligent lock system and improve management system, different accounts can be arranged to different authorities, authority can be provided with administrator right, responsible consumer authority and normal user permission, keeper has all authorities, comprises management responsible consumer and domestic consumer, unblanks, shuts, arranges main website IP etc.; Responsible consumer authority comprises unblanks, shuts, arranges main website IP etc.; Domestic consumer only has search access right.Further, when logging in, its password is issued immediately by keeper when opening operation order, and namely no matter whether account is identical, and the password that logs in when at every turn logging in is different at every turn.
Open by adopting above-described safety intelligent lock system and safety intelligent lock, close locking method, achieve out, shut action and by the multiple information before securely unlocking and password authentification, ensure securely unlocking, the key anti-lock compared with five based on the key volume of this safety intelligent lock system is much little, lock system cost reduces, intelligence, easy to operate, safe and reliable, prevent from being opened by mistake lock, simultaneously owing to have employed the overall management of communication network and main website, information storage function, can to the operand of switch lock, operating personnel, Obj State, the information such as running time effectively record and manage, the perfect management system of power domain.
The above portable electric appts comprises the portable electric appts that mobile phone, panel computer and notebook etc. have bluetooth module and communication function.
